Discovering the Magic of Three Kings Day in Cadiz

The sun shines over the waters of the Atlantic, caressing the golden beaches of Cadiz as the city prepares to celebrate one of the most special days of the year: Three Kings Day. In this enchanting land in southern Spain, the holiday takes on a unique glow, filling the streets with laughter, music and the magic of illusion.

The Cavalcade: A Parade of Emotions


Three Kings Day in Cadiz begins with one of the most awaited traditions: the Cavalcade. This colorful and festive parade runs through the main streets of the city, carrying with it the magical essence of the season. Floats decorated with sparkling lights, fantastic characters and, of course, the three Wise Men, Melchior, Gaspar and Balthazar, greet the excited crowds that throng along the route.


The children, their eyes full of wonder, anxiously await the arrival of the Three Kings, who throw candy and small gifts as they pass by. Music fills the air, creating an atmosphere of joy that mixes with the fresh sea breeze characteristic of Cadiz.


The tradition of the gifts and the Rosca de Reyes (Three Kings Bread Roll)


After the Cabalgata, families gather to share a special feast that includes the traditional Rosca de Reyes. This delicious sweet bread, decorated with candied fruit and sugar, is the star of the table. The custom dictates that whoever finds the figurine hidden in his or her portion will be the "king" or "queen" for a day.


The carefully wrapped gifts are exchanged among friends and family while laughter and good wishes are shared. The magic of Three Kings Day lies in the generosity and affection that permeates every gesture, creating indelible memories.
